WUPPERTAL MUNICIPAL UTILITIES Case Study: Reactivation Using Sustainable Coconut-Shell-Based Make-Up Carbon WSW Energie & Wasser AG (WSW) is part of Wuppertaler Stadtwerke GmbH, located in the German federal state of North Rhine–Westphalia. WSW operates three water treatment plants with a total of 24 granular activated carbon (GAC) filters: Dabringhausen (12 filters, approx. 45m³ each), Herbringhausen…
